Full Job Description
Description

Tharros is seeking a Senior Security Governance and Policy Analyst to support a DHS Intelligence and Analysis cybersecurity program in the National Capital Region.

This role will support cybersecurity governance, policy, compliance, and executive communications across a complex mission environment. The ideal candidate can translate Federal, DHS, and Intelligence Community cybersecurity policy into practical implementation plans and help senior cybersecurity leaders drive consistent governance across cloud, on-premise, classified, and unclassified environments.

Responsibilities:

  • Serve as a senior cybersecurity governance and policy advisor supporting cybersecurity leadership.
  • Analyze cybersecurity requirements derived from policies, directives, standards, and guidance.
  • Develop and update cybersecurity policies, standards, governance documentation, and implementation recommendations.
  • Support governance activities related to RMF, FISMA, CNSSI standards, NIST 800-53, security control catalogs, supply chain risk management, AI/ML security considerations, and cybersecurity compliance.
  • Review changes to Federal, DHS, Intelligence Community, and other applicable cybersecurity policies and recommend practical implementation approaches.
  • Support updates to security policy manuals, supply chain risk management policy, security control catalogs, and related governance artifacts.
  • Coordinate with governance, risk, and compliance stakeholders to support accurate control mapping and policy implementation.
  • Research new or updated cybersecurity Executive Orders, Intelligence Community policies, national security guidance, and related requirements.
  • Support cybersecurity audit response activities, including inspection, compliance, and oversight-related efforts.
  • Prepare executive summaries, reports, talking points, briefings, stakeholder communications, and senior-leader presentation materials.
  • Support cybersecurity governance working groups, taskers, data calls, trackers, repositories, and policy reference updates.
  • Help identify opportunities to improve governance processes, streamline policy implementation, and increase consistency across cybersecurity compliance activities.
